ASSETs

Overview

ASSETs (After School Safety and Enrichment for Teens) is an expanded learning program providing high quality, youth driven out-of-school-time opportunities to students enrolled at Hiram Johnson High School. We offer enrichment, for-credit courses and non-credit courses to students in all grades as well as academic mentoring and educational development programs. The ASSETs administrative office is located in C-3.

Student Support Services

Overview
Student Support Center Homepage

Students and families who would like free supportive assistance for personal, home, or school-related issues, are welcome to call or drop by the Student Support Center (located in Room F-1). The Center is open during the school year. 

Services are confidential (except in those situations when a student’s safety is at risk), and are available in English and Spanish.

Cub Support Online Tutoring

Overview

Cub Support is an organization that provides FREE 1-on-1 online tutoring to K-12 students! If you are a K-12 student at any U.S. school, you are automatically eligible for our services and may request tutoring in up to two (2) subjects of your choice. After signing up, you’ll be matched with a college student tutor who will provide you with personalized academic support. Our services are 100% free!
